I'm also having troubles with iTunes, the wife's "new" nano, my old clickwheel, and foo_pod.
I can get foopod to connect to the ipod, operate as expected and transfer music by disabling ipod services before starting (otherwise, crash). However, when transferring files using foo_pod the database appears to get mugged. On the nano everything disappears from the music directory when viewed from iTunes, but the ipod shows and plays these files fine. My oldschool click-wheel doesn't exhibit this particular behavior. By "rebuilding database" and "finding skipped files" everything appears in the ipod "music" list, but some of the recently transfered from itunes get's skipped during playback. The fix for this is transferring a file and forcing itunes to "Determine gapless playback information" which can be long and time consuming. For reference, I'm running the latest foo_pod, iTunes 7.0.2.16. Everything works in a way, but I'd love to know if I missed something. |

Preferences - iPod manager
In Conversion Command box enter: CODE "path_to_your_encoder" -S --noreplaygain -V 5 --vbr-new - %d You may want to play with switches though. -------------------- Sharing delusions since 1991.

I had this problem that iTunes kept deleting music that I added with foo_pod. I wrote a small blog entry, that I'm reposting here.
Note; - itunes for podcasts - foobar for music ################################ Stop itunes from deleting music added with foo_pod Steps # Plug in your ipod. # Start itunes and go to the "devices list". # You now should have the screen that list your ipod, (name, capacity, software version.) Head down until you find the Options listing. # Make sure to select "manually manage music and videos". *The setting should allow you to manage your music with Foobar/foo_pod and itunes should no longer remove all the newly added music when you sync your pod-casts with itunes. |
